How to start Vuforia Studio on Windows without to be affected by system environment variable HOME
Modified: 12-Jan-2023
Applies To
- Vuforia Studio 8.3.5 to 9.7.0
Description
- Once install of Vuforia Studio is completed on Windows, the Vuforia Studio window appears and clicking Open, Vuforia Studio is opened in the browser at localhost:3000
- If the system environment variable HOME is not set, by default All Projects created are stored under USERPROFILE\Documents\VuforiaStudio\Projects
- On setting system environment variable HOME and restarting Vuforia Studio, the related Projects folder are created under specified path. From Windows System Property, select <Environment Variable> and set as below to add the variable:
Variable name: HOME
Value: Any local path. e.g: C:\studio\projects
